Advertisement … WebAnother way to calculate the geometric mean is with logarithms, as it is also the average of logarithmic values converted back to base 10. Let's say you want to calculate the geomean of 2 and 8. It is handy to use log with base 2 here, so 2 = 2 1 and 8 = 2 3. The arithmetic mean of the exponents (1 and 3) is 2, so the geometric mean is 2 2 = 4 ...
